## Releases

Starting with Lattermill 4.2, the orders table uses soft deletes exclusively. Rows are never removed; instead, deleted_at is set and all read paths must filter on it. Future maintainers should note that the nightly reconciler in Quarrelsome still assumes hard deletes, so the shim in ordersvc must stay in place until that job is rewritten. Release artifacts for 4.2 and later are signed before upload, and verification happens in the deploy pipeline. Verify each build against the key below.

release key, fajef-kajeg: bky19_LdLu6Ne6FLi8he2c24d

Title: Gridsmith crossword generator produces unsolvable corners

The generator occasionally places two-letter slots in the top-right corner that no dictionary entry can fill, then loops retrying forever. Repro: seed 4412, 15x15 symmetric grid, themed mode off. Workaround: cap backtracking at 500 attempts and regenerate. New folks: start in fill/corner_solver.py. The regression first appeared in the build listed below.

build token for yajof-bajof: htk31_506ff1188f74596b5bb2eec94edc43c

TURN-208: Gatevale turnstile counters at the Merrow Field pilot double-count when a rotation reverses mid-cycle. Attendance totals drift roughly 2% high per event. The debounce window fix is implemented, reviewed by Ilsa, and soak-tested across two simulated match days without drift. Ready for your cut; the candidate build is identified below.

trace token, tagag-tafog: htk6_5ed18c